Life Lessons by Chris Weidman

  1. Chris Weidman's work emphasizes the importance of hard work, dedication, and resilience. He has shown that through consistent effort and dedication, it is possible to reach the highest levels of success.
  2. Weidman's career also highlights the importance of having a strong support system and believing in yourself. He has credited his family, friends, and coaches for their support and guidance throughout his journey.
  3. Finally, Weidman's story serves as a reminder that anything is possible with the right attitude and determination. He has shown that with enough dedication and focus, you can achieve your goals no matter the odds.
